Torque Arm
I have an 86 Iroc, I am putting in a Morrison 4 bar rear clip with a narrowed 9 inch, also using their weld in frame connectors. I am running a GM 572 crate motor with a procharger F2. With the full frame is it neccessary to still use the torque arm? and if so why
Thanks for the help

Re: Torque Arm
if you're going to install a 4-link "back-half", then that's all you will be using. The subframe connectors would be a moot point, as you need to look into fabricating framerails, or having it done.
You're looking at tackling a MAJOR alteration with what would seem to be little knowledge of what you are doing. - Do a search under "back-half" and look at Stephen's car domain page. There will be A LOT of custom fabrication required for what you are talking about
also, this really should be under the suspension forum.
